안녕하세요!

계속해서 yaffs 에 관한 문의를 합니다. 지난번에 답변 감사합니다.

yaffs file system을 이용하여 mount를 하여 저장 공간으로 .. 사용하고 있읍
니다.

근데, 용량의 한계가 계속해서 7MB를 넘지를 못합니다.
여러번 테스트를 했는데, 용량이 7MB 밖에 write를 못합니다!

df 명령으로 확인 하면

***
***
/dev/mtdblock2 61424 7816 13% /data 입니다.

분명히 64M 공간에 7M 사용하고 있는데, write가 안됩니다.

테스트 환경은 다음과 같습니다.

테스트 응용프로그램 ( "/data/test.txt")를 생성하여 계속해서 특정값을
write 하는 프로그램이고, ramdisk img 에 포함 하여 실행 합니다!

그리고, 프로그램을 실행하면, "/data/test.txt"를 생성하여 누적하여 가는데,
7M를 넘지를 못합니다.
그래서 콘솔에서 파일생성하면,
Ex) cat > test.c
bash: test.c: Cannot allocate memory 라는 메세지가 나타납니다

개인적으로 원인 무엇인지 궁금하고, 물론 프로젝트 하는데도 필요 합니다.
그럼..